Meaning of Sahna
The name Sahna comes from the Pashto language, where it directly translates to ‘peace,’ ‘tranquility,’ or ‘calmness.’ In Pashto, the word ‘sahna’ (سهنه) is used to describe a state of peacefulness and serenity. This meaning reflects the cultural values of Pashtun communities who prize harmony and peaceful coexistence. The name has been adopted in some Persian and Urdu-speaking regions with similar peaceful connotations. Origin & Cultural Significance
Sahna originates from the Pashto language, spoken primarily by Pashtun communities in Afghanistan and Pakistan. The name reflects the cultural importance of peace and harmony in Pashtun traditions. While commonly used among Muslim families, it is not exclusively Islamic and appears across different faiths within Pashtun communities. The name has gained popularity beyond its original linguistic boundaries, appearing in various South Asian naming traditions. Its peaceful meaning makes it appealing to parents seeking names with positive, calming connotations for their daughters.
